Born Once again Soldiers Penticton: Key Christian Society?

From the serene town of Penticton, British Columbia, an enigmatic team often called the Born Once again Troopers of God (BSG) is quietly producing its mark. Though their charitable operate—supporting the homeless, aiding those battling habit, and assisting Culture's most marginalized—has acquired them praise, a way of secrecy clings to them. Wh

read more